Gameiro: "We have to win our next two Champions League games at home"
Kevin Gameiro set up Denis Cheryshev for a goal that nearly gave Valencia CF the three points against Lille, and the Frenchman emphasised the importance of taking victory in both of the remaining Champions League home games.
“It was a very difficult match. We managed to go ahead, but we didn’t manage to get the win. We leave here with four points in the group, and now we are going to fight hard at home,” said a determined Gameiro after the final whistle.

“We lacked many things. LOSC Lille pressed us a lot, are very physical and put a lot of pace into the game. This is the Champions League, and details make the difference.”
Gameiro said that the sole focus was on the task at hand, and had been unaware of the scoreline in the other Group H game, between Ajax and Chelsea in Amsterdam.
“We didn’t know about the result in that game. We play to win and we are going to fight to qualify for the knockout stages, right to the end,” he underlined. “Now we have our next two Champions League games at home, and we have to win them. After that, we’ll see what happens.”
